CHARACTERISTICS OF SEDIMENT TRANSPORT AND TOPOGRAPHY CHANGE OF THE MIXED SAND AND GRAVEL BEACH
Field measurements were carried out on two beaches composed of mixed sand and gravel to investigate the spatial distributions of bet material and topography change. It is found that difference of transport direction between fine sand and coarse material causes sorting of grain size in cross-shore direction. Numerical simulations are also done to reproduce the measured responses of beach profile. A so-called SBEACH model was extended to simulate sorting process of the bed materials in the cross-shore direction due to difference of transport direction between fine and coarse materials and topography change. Simulated topographies gave qualitative explanation for the observed one by field measurements.
